How they compare
Bulgaria currently reports 0.789 Mt CO2e against 0.671 Mt CO2e in Belarus, a difference of 0.118 Mt CO2e.
That makes Bulgaria's figure about 1.2 times Belarus's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 55 shared years of data; in 1970 it was Bulgaria ahead.
Belarus ranks 34th and Bulgaria ranks 31st of 110 countries.
Bulgaria has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.

About this data
A measure of annual emissions of carbon dioxide (CO2), one of the six Kyoto greenhouse gases (GHG), from the agricultural sector. This includes emissions from livestock (IPCC 2006 codes 3.A.1 (enteric fermentation, 3.a.2 (manure management) and crops (IPCC 2006 codes 3.C.1 Emissions from biomass burning, 3.C.2 Liming, 3.C.3 Urea application, 3.C.4 Direct N2O Emissions from managed soils, 3.C.5 Indirect N2O Emissions from managed soils, 3.C.6 Indirect N2O Emissions from manure management, 3.C.7 Rice cultivations). The measure is standardized to carbon dioxide equivalent values using the Global Warming Potential (GWP) factors of IPCC's 5th Assessment Report (AR5).
